DESCRIPTION:Struggling to give feedback that makes an impact? Join Tem as she delves into effective feedback strategies to help teachers empower their students. Tem explores actionable tips on providing students with clear and specific feedback to promote understanding, improvement, and a love of learning, as well as saving teachers time!KEY TAKEAWAYS:Feedback should be specific and timely for it to have an input on the learning of our students and lead to improvements in their work.Live marking is a great strategy to help save teacher's time. Teaching Assistants and Teachers should circulate the room giving students both written and verbal feedback as this makes the most impact.Self assessment and peer assessment prior to the teacher marking their work can help save time and improves student knowledge and understanding of the criteria.Use the feedback sandwich technique: start with a positive, followed by constructive criticism, and then end with a positive comment.Acknowledge efforts and celebrate small improvements. Students need to experience small successes along the way to help keep them motivated.Link feedback given to the lesson objective or success criteria to make it more meaningful to the students. Managing Next Generation Energy Systems Cambridge University Background Stakeholders working with energy systems have to make complex decisions formulated from risk-based assessments about the future. The move towards more renewables in our energy systems complicates matters even further, requiring the development of an integrated power grid and continuous and steady transformation of the UK power system. Network flows must be managed reliably under uncertain demands, uncertain supply, emerging network technologies and possible failures and, further, prices in related markets can be highly volatile. Mathematicians working with engineers and economists, can make significant contributions to address such issues, by helping to develop fit-for-purpose models for next generation energy systems. These interdisciplinary approaches are looking to address a range of associated problems, including modelling, prediction, simulation, control, market and mechanism design and optimisation.
